    Leverage Edge Computing for Faster Responses with Real-Time Processing

    Rose RuckBy Rose RuckAugust 21, 2024

    In today’s fast-paced online world, speed is everything. Businesses and consumers alike expect instant responses, whether they’re engaging with customer service chatbots, managing smart devices, or navigating autonomous systems. AI agents play a critical role in meeting these expectations, but their performance is only as good as the infrastructure supporting them. This is where edge computing comes into play, offering a powerful solution for enabling real-time processing and faster responses.

    The Need for Speed in AI Processing

    AI agents are designed to mimic human decision-making and perform tasks autonomously. However, the effectiveness of these agents often hinges on how quickly they can process data and respond to changing conditions. Traditional cloud-based computing models, while robust, can introduce lag due to the time it takes to send data back and forth between devices and centralized servers. This latency can be an annoying bottleneck, especially in applications that require real-time decision-making, such as electric vehicles, healthcare monitoring systems, and industrial automation.

    Understanding Edge Computing

    Edge computing is a distributed computing paradigm that brings computation and data storage closer to the location where it is needed. Instead of relying solely on centralized cloud servers, edge computing allows data to be processed at or near the source of data generation—often on devices themselves or on local servers. This proximity reduces the distance data must travel, thereby significantly cutting down on latency and enabling faster processing times.

    How Edge Computing Enhances AI Agents

    Integrating edge computing with AI agents can drastically improve their responsiveness. By processing data locally, AI agents can make decisions in real time without waiting for instructions from distant servers. This is particularly helpful in environments where milliseconds can make a difference, such as in financial trading systems or emergency response scenarios. Edge computing not only speeds up data processing but also enhances the reliability of AI agents, as they become less dependent on a stable internet connection to function effectively.

    Real-World Applications of Edge-Enhanced AI Agents

    Several industries are already reaping the benefits of combining AI agents with edge computing. In smart cities, for example, edge-enabled AI agents are used to monitor traffic conditions and adjust signals in real time, reducing congestion and improving safety. In healthcare, wearable devices equipped with AI can process patient data on the spot, allowing for quicker diagnoses and treatment adjustments. Similarly, in manufacturing, edge computing allows AI-driven robots to perform complex tasks with precision, reacting instantaneously to changes in the production line.

    Challenges and Considerations

    While the advantages of edge computing for AI agents are clear, there are also challenges to consider. Implementing edge computing infrastructure requires significant investment in hardware and software development. Additionally, there is the challenge of ensuring data security and privacy when processing sensitive information on local devices. However, these challenges are increasingly being addressed with advancements in encryption technologies and secure data management practices.
